DATABASE OF ESTONIAN ARTICLES INDEX SCRIPTORUM ESTONIAE (ISE)

ISE

On January 2009 the database of Estonian articles, Index Scriptorium Estoniae (ISE), at http://ise.elnet.ee was opened to users. This database, the result of cooperation between 12 libraries in the ELNET Consortium, contains articles, from newspapers, magazines and journals, serial publications and anthologies and collections from the 1990s on allowing the full-text to be accessed in free digital archives and Web publications.

The official name of the database is "Eesti artiklite andmebaas Index Scriptorum Estoniae" and its official abbreviation is ISE. The official name in English is "Database of Estonian Articles Index Scriptorum Estoniae".

In essence, articles are categorized into the following thematic databases:

  • education;
  • humanities;
  • language and literature;
  • art, music, theatre, film;
  • social sciences;
  • nature and physical science;
  • medicine and health care;
  • rural economy and the environment;
  • sport, tourism, leisure time;
  • technology, industry, construction, IT.

    One should take into consideration that some Russian-language articles (older period) were transliterated, newer ones appear in Cyrillic.

    About 200 new articles are added to the database each day.

    The database can be used free of charge, in Estonian or English. To provide access to the database over the internet, the official address (ise.elnet.ee) together with the official name or logo should be used.
